Plants need minerals from the soil to grow well. But repeated use


of soil drains the minerals from it and fewer crops are produced.


The farming industry uses agrochemicals to
help them improve the quality of the soil,
and also to fight off the insect pests,
diseases, and weeds that would
otherwise destroy their crops.

WHAT IS ORGANIC FARMING?
Because of the effect of artificial sprays
and fertilizers on the environment, organic
farmers choose not to use them. Instead,
they use animal manure and compost, and
rotate their crops with beans and peas to
replace nitrogen in the soil. They also control
pests with natural methods, such as planting
onions between carrots to discourage carrot fly.

A pharmaceutical is any substance used to treat or prevent


disease. Since ancient times, people have experimented with plants


as medicines, often poisoning themselves, but sometimes finding


substances with real benefits – aspirin, for example. Today, the


pharmaceutical industry is based on stricter scientific methods.


WHAT ARE SELECTIVE WEEDKILLERS?
In the past, farmers tried to kill weeds with sea salt
and other common chemicals. But these substances
killed crops as well. Modern herbicides (weedkillers)
are organic chemicals designed to limit weed growth.
Many are selective, which means that they kill the
weeds but do little harm to the crop.

HOW ARE NEW DRUGS DEVELOPED?


Now that biochemists understand the chemicals in


living cells, they can design molecules to combat


illness. Molecules can be made in a laboratory and


tested on cells in a culture (in vitro). Successful


compounds are then tested on animals (in vivo).


HOW ARE NEW DRUGS TESTED?


When a drug has been tested in a laboratory it is


given to patients in tests called clinical trials. In these,


some patients are given the new drug while others


receive a placebo (a dummy medicine). Because the


patients do not know which drug they have received,


the test will show if the drug has a genuine effect.


DRUG MANUFACTURE 1
This mould is used for shaping
tablets (pills). Pills contain the
drugs prescribed for patients by
doctors. Each drug is made into a
pill with a different shape, colour,
size, or pattern. This makes it less
likely that the wrong pill will be
taken by mistake.

4 TAKING DRUGS
Most types of drug are taken
orally (by mouth) in the form of
tablets or pills, or as powders.
Some drugs are swallowed in
liquid form, and some are
injected using a hypodermic
syringe. Some drugs can also be
absorbed through the skin.

1 CROP SPRAYING
Fruit trees in an orchard are
sprayed with pesticides to control
insects and other pests that
would damage the fruit or the
trees. At the same time, care
must be taken not to kill helpful
insects, such as bees.
